He accepted that learners must accommodate to each other and to their environment in Pragmatism and schools should introduce social experiences. “All learning is dependent on the context of place, time, and circumstance” (Four General or World Philosophies). Diverse; cultural and ethnic groups should learn to function and contribute to a democratic society. A definitive ambition for existing is the formation of an advanced social order. Character advancement relies upon making group decisions in light of outcomes. Teaching methods for pragmatists focus more on hands-on problem critical thinking, experimenting and projects, compelling students working in groups. Educational programs ought to unite the controls to focus on dealing with issues in an interdisciplinary way instead of going down sorted out groups of information to new students. Pragmatists understand students should apply their knowledge to genuine conditions through trial request.
